Output 3ac3e03b51cde633b58bd7fa84fc38630f344539ed1b1652e0a43df4d452968e:1

value
3788000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 963407c7266180796c03089016ff22a3a410d78d OP_EQUALVERIFY OP_CHECKSIG
address
1EhCguic31tFaSmmL1b4equ9fJD3yVBMXc
transaction
3ac3e03b51cde633b58bd7fa84fc38630f344539ed1b1652e0a43df4d452968e
spent
true